Maintaining and sharpening your Roselli Carving knife
Sharpening your carving knife
Use a sharpening stone: Start with a coarse stone and work your way to a finer grit.
Maintain the angle: Keep a consistent angle (typically around 14 degrees on each side) while sharpening.
Use a honing strop: After sharpening, finish by stropping the blade on a leather strop to refine the edge.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
How often should I sharpen my Roselli Carving knife?
It depends on usage, but sharpening every few months or when you notice dullness will keep it in top shape.
What type of wood is best for carving with Roselli knives?
Softwoods like basswood and birch are great for beginners, while seasoned carvers may prefer harder woods.
Can I use Roselli Carving knives for other woodworking tasks?
Yes! They are versatile and work well for various precision woodworking projects.
